Jesup & Lamont Initiates Coverage on Atlas Air Worldwide Holdings (AAWW) with a Hold
Jesup & Lamont initiates coverage on Atlas Air Worldwide Holdings Inc (Nasdaq: AAWW) with a Hold.
Jesup analyst says, "Atlas Air emerged from Chapter 11 in 2004 having restructured its operations following a 2002 bankruptcy filing. The company was able to eliminate some of its unprofitable Classic Boeing 727-200 aircraft during the bankruptcy filing. Atlas Air operates a fleet of 37 Boeing 747-200 and -400 aircraft. Atlas has long term relationships with its major customers, including DHL, British Airways, Emirates, Qantas and the US military. Atlas staggers its contract renewals so that it does not have more than three renewals in any one year. Atlas’ growth model includes customer and geographic expansion, seeking to grow in the Asia Pacific and the Middle Eastern markets. The US is not a viable growth market for Atlas Air because of various (labor) contract restrictions that US airlines have with its pilots. Other potential opportunities for outsourcing include crew and training, as well as aircraft management and servicing."
Atlas Air Worldwide Holdings, Inc. (AAWW) provides leased freighter aircraft, furnishing outsourced air cargo operating services and solutions to the global air freight industry.
